Abstract: This work deals with the research work involved in the design of efficient system for intelligent video surveillance applications. A system of video/image fusion and enhancement for visibility improvement is proposed in this work for intelligent surveillance at night or under bad weather conditions. Two videos are acquired, one by a color CCD camera, and the other by a infrared camera (IR). Before performing multispectral fusion, image registration and image preprocessing (denoising, Normalization and enhancement) are required. The IR image and the visible image are then fused. First, a pixel-level multi-resolution based image fusion method is applied to source images. Techniques which will be used in multispectral fusion are Discrete Wavelet Transform(DWT) then the Dual-Tree Complex Wavelet Transform (DT-CWT). After image fusion, a color restoration is performed on fused images with the chromatic information of visible images. We will propose a Modified Look-Up Table (LUT) technique to color the night video. The entire image processing and analysis system will be developed in Matlab/Simulink environment. Preliminary results of fusion obtained in some experiments are presented.
